Agents that antagonize the effects of acetylcholine are called anticholinergic.
<span>Anticholinergic blocks this neurotransmitter acetylcholine within the nervous system, by deactivating nerve impulses as a result of the binding of this neurotransmitter so that it cannot reach its receptor in nerve cells.</span>
